The Grand Prix of Emilia Romagna is one of the few races where there is no threat of grid penalties prior to a Grand Prix. No driver has suffered grid penalties and no one has been investigated by the FIA, for example by blocking another driver or changing parts.
That is why we will see a Mercedes 1-2 at the start of the race in Imola. Behind it are two Honda engines, in the shape of Max Verstappen and Pierre Gasly. From P3 to P6 there are only (former) Red Bull Racing drivers, because behind Verstappen and Gasly are Daniel Ricciardo and Alexander Albon.

Perez and Ocon tyre advantage

The fifth driver with a Red Bull history, Daniil Kvyat, starts from P8 with Charles Leclerc just ahead of him from P7. The McLaren duo, Carlos Sainz and Lando Norris, will start from the fifth row of the grid. Sergio Perez and Esteban Ocon will be the first drivers with a free choice of tyres and will therefore start the attack on the top ten, where many drivers will have to start on old soft tyres.
